Output 720de4bf52fe85ae30a71221135da386b1b7d863483c5ca801044154b21dce4a:1

value
32514870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64c2a38e3113c97a9f029e353cd838a072608a22 OP_EQUAL
address
3AsnfUSHbuNLGfi4CvGvZAn3XRmWw8x16S
transaction
720de4bf52fe85ae30a71221135da386b1b7d863483c5ca801044154b21dce4a
spent
true